If you’ve been around Birmingham for any stretch of time, chances are you’ve seen the signs (literally) or heard of the legendary Annual Chili Cook-Off hosted by the Exceptional Foundation. What started as a small community gathering has become a can’t-miss annual tradition, drawing thousands of attendees each year. (Last year alone, 14,000 people attended.)

This year, on Saturday, March 7, the Exceptional Foundation’s 22nd Annual Chili Cook-Off is moving to a new home: The Urban Center at Liberty Park in Vestavia Hills (1000 Urban Center Dr.). Here’s what to expect:

FOOD + FAMILY-FRIENDLY FUN

From 10:30 a.m. to 2 p.m., savor all-you-can-eat chili, sip beverages—including beer from Good People Brewing and Avondale Brewing—and enjoy live music at the Exceptional Foundation’s largest event of the year. Feel free to send your kiddos to the kids’ zone so they can have fun, too (just maybe before they consume too much chili… if you know what I mean). And did I mention kids 12 and under are free?!

COMPETITORS BRING THE HEAT

Nothing like some good old-fashioned competition to spice things up! Guests can expect the same fun atmosphere in this new location, plus more than 100 teams serving up their best chili recipes—from family secrets to daring new blends. (Last year’s Chili Cook-Off featured 138 cook teams—we’ll see how many are cooking something up this year.)

Sample until your heart’s content—or your belly’s full—then vote for your favorites. Needless to say, you won’t want to miss this showdown.

SUPPORT AN EXCEPTIONAL CAUSE

Plus, all proceeds go directly to The Exceptional Foundation’s programs for adults and youth with intellectual disabilities. Think of it this way: You get to fill your belly, have fun, and help fund an incredible local nonprofit that offers year-round social and recreational opportunities for individuals with special needs.
